Transaction 21e9521bca3e9e25bb2c76ee4e4379fbdf412bbc13ad2b4d5dd6c60066efc471
1 Input
1 Output
-
21e9521bca3e9e25bb2c76ee4e4379fbdf412bbc13ad2b4d5dd6c60066efc471:0
- value
- 23818583
- script pubkey
- OP_0 OP_PUSHBYTES_20 846dba61a92aef05a8f1656351cd10b03dab4d95
- address
- bc1qs3km5cdf9thst283v434rngskq76knv4lq96qy